Events to RealSystem 5.0 Digital Renaissance, a leading provider of technology solutions for digital media communications, today announced T.A.G.(TM) 1.5, a significant upgrade to its medialinking technology. Available today, T.A.G. 1.5 provides full support for RealNetworks' RealSystem(TM) 5.0 streaming media See streaming audio, streaming video and digital media hub. system, allowing Web developers the most comprehensive solution for publishing synchronized events to RealSystem 5.0. Additionally, since T.A.G. 1.5 integrates directly into RealSystem 5.0 software components, development time is drastically reduced; there's no need for end-users to download additional plug-ins; and it increases the ability to publish synchronized events to streaming or live media. The total number of RealPlayers that have been distributed is more than 35 million. For example, with T.A.G., an end-user viewing video on the Web can link to additional related information simultaneously without interrupting the flow of the video, allowing the developer to transform linear video into a multidimensional, interactive experience. T.A.G. supports multiple media types and the largest set of media players. Visit the T.A.G. Web site at http://tag.digital-ren.com for more information.
